Do Not Have an Alcoholic Beverage … Gamble!

If you like to have a beverage every now and then, leave your cash out of the casino if you are going to do your consuming in a casino. I am serious. Leave your evening bag, your money belt, and leave all money, plastic credit and checkbooks out of the casino. Only take whatever cash you anticipate to spend on beverages, tipping and few dollars you expect to burn and leave the remainder behind.

Pessimistic? Absolutely not. Just realistic. You could have a win after a boozy evening out with your buddies and be lucky enough to hook a long toss at a smokin craps game. Hang on to that adventure seeing that it’s as short-lived as it gets if you consistently drink alcohol and bet. These activities just don’t mix.

Leaving your money back at the hotel is a little bit drastic, but preventative actions for excessive behavior is required. If you bet to succeed, then do not consume alcohol and play. If you like to blow your $$$$ nary a worry, then drink all the gratuitous alcohol your stomach are able to handle, but do not carry credit cards and cheques to throw into the mix of following losses after your dead drunk head squanders every little thing!
